整个事件的IL代码
[MethodImpl(MethodImplOptions.NoOptimization)]
public static bool smethod_3(object object_3, string string_5)
{
try
{
string text = Conversions.ToString(Operators.ConcatenateObject(Operators.ConcatenateObject(Operators.ConcatenateObject(Operators.ConcatenateObject(Operators.ConcatenateObject(Operators.ConcatenateObject(Operators.ConcatenateObject(Operators.ConcatenateObject(Operators.ConcatenateObject(Operators.ConcatenateObject(Class22.smethod_0(10000000, 99999999), Class26.string_1), Class6.smethod_0()), Class26.string_1), Class6.smethod_1()), Class26.string_1), "0"), Class26.string_1), object_3), Class26.string_1), Class15.smethod_0(string_5)));
Class7.Class8 @class = new Class7.Class8();
string str = @class.method_2(text, Class26.cWolcolgAg(), 256, Conversions.ToString(0), 128);
string string_6 = "http://sq.qq6.name/action.aspx?A=" + str;
string text2 = Class26.smethod_2(string_6);
if (text2 == null)
{
Interaction.MsgBox("登录失败(0)!", MsgBoxStyle.OkOnly, null);
bool result = false;
return result;
}
string text3 = @class.method_3(text2, Class26.smethod_1(), 256, Conversions.ToString(0), 128);
if (text3 == null)
{
Interaction.MsgBox("登录失败(1)!", MsgBoxStyle.OkOnly, null);
bool result = false;
return result;
}
if (Operators.CompareString(text3, "", true) == 0)
{
Interaction.MsgBox("登录失败(2)!", MsgBoxStyle.OkOnly, null);
bool result = false;
return result;
}
string[] array = Strings.Split(text3, Class26.string_1, -1, CompareMethod.Text);
if (array.Length < 3)
{
Interaction.MsgBox("登录失败(3)!", MsgBoxStyle.OkOnly, null);
ProjectData.EndApp();
bool result = false;
return result;
}
string left = array[0];
if (Operators.CompareString(left, "0", true) == 0)
{
string left2 = array[1];
if (Operators.CompareString(left2, "-1", true) == 0)
{
ProjectData.EndApp();
bool result = false;
return result;
}
if (Operators.CompareString(left2, "0", true) == 0)
{
Interaction.MsgBox(array[2], MsgBoxStyle.OkOnly, null);
bool result = false;
return result;
}
if (Operators.CompareString(left2, "1", true) == 0)
{
Class26.object_0 = object_3;
Class26.string_2 = Class15.smethod_0(string_5);
Class26.string_3 = array[3];
Class26.object_1 = array[4];
Class26.object_2 = array[5];
Class26.bool_0 = false;
bool result = true;
return result;
}
}
}
catch (Exception expr_1F8)
{
ProjectData.SetProjectError(expr_1F8);
ProjectData.ClearProjectError();
}
ProjectData.EndApp();
return false;
}
我的目的是要把下面的代码修改成
string text3 =“123” 但是我试过了N种办法最后修改过后的效果始终都是string text2 =我也是奇怪了不管怎么修改都是string text2 =
已经纠结了我好几个夜晚了 实在是感觉到无助特来看雪求助 希望技术大牛 给予帮助
只有20看雪币了 如果我在追加 拜托了.
string text3 = @class.method_3(text2, Class26.smethod_1(), 256, Conversions.ToString(0), 128);
[培训]内核驱动高级班,冲击BAT一流互联网大厂工作,每周日13:00-18:00直播授课